Printing
Okay I've installed cupsys and cupsys-gimp-print. I pointed my browser
to http://localhost:631 and set up my epson color stylus 600. When I
print a test page it prints beautifully. My problem is none of my
programs can use the printer. All of them want to print to lpr or in the
case of mozilla, Postscript/default. When I try to print anythiing
nothing happens.
I tried lpoptions -d epson (which is what I named my printer). Is there
a dpkg-reconfigure <whatever> that will do a system wide configuration
for all my programs to us the printer I just installed?
